Transaction 175d17ebae309f2da6386128fbcf9a4d6256b2640c972c0192140c93c7cd7d7a
1 Input
1 Output
-
175d17ebae309f2da6386128fbcf9a4d6256b2640c972c0192140c93c7cd7d7a:0
- value
- 23114
- script pubkey
- OP_0 OP_PUSHBYTES_32 c9750a51b8a3fffb51e77140bc1c3ecb46b7110f7218f0428a68911ce9b462a0
- address
- bc1qe96s55dc50llk508w9qtc8p7edrtwyg0wgv0qs52dzg3e6d5v2squfm3ex